The Fire Prevention Division in Spokane, Washington, is dedicated to promoting fire safety and compliance through various initiatives and community programs. With a focus on public education, they offer outreach that targets both children and adults, including the impactful Youth Firesetter Prevention program and the Children's Fire Safety House. The division's inspectors ensure adherence to fire codes by conducting site and building inspections and issuing necessary permits for different events and occupancies. They also play a key role in planning for special events, ensuring that safety measures are in place.
